About Cernunnos

The Iron Age settlement at Cernunnos sits quietly near Great Yarmouth, a place where archaeology enthusiasts actually get excited about shallow ditches and pottery shards. This isn't Stonehenge - there's no dramatic stone circle or towering monument. What you're looking at are the earthwork remains of an ancient enclosure, evidence of Iron Age occupation that tells you something real about how people lived here two thousand years ago.

The site itself is modest. You'll see defensive ditches, some banks, and if you're lucky the interpretation boards will still be standing. It's the kind of place that rewards a bit of historical imagination - conjure the roundhouses, the livestock, the daily struggles - but won't hold young children's attention for long. Walkers and history buffs will find it worthwhile as part of a broader Norfolk exploration, particularly if you're interested in pre-Roman Britain.
